Again, best of men and friend, a small consignment is ready for you from here, and
then also another
large
Australian Crocodile will reach you specially packed. The latter alone with packing
and freight costs about
ten
£. You see therefore that I spare no sacrifice to be useful to you. I would like
now to know from you after closer investigation whether this species is different
from the Indian.

The large specimen goes off per "Scottish Prince" from Queensland direct to you (per Blackith & Co); I am sending a smaller specimen
with the other things to Dr Sonder, as you will gather from the enclosed note.
Of the Apteryx skins and Strigops skins, as well as of the skeletons of these birds, I ask you to kindly send 1 specimen
to the museum of my native town Rostock.
Always your
Ferd. von Mueller.
